ATlAnTo-AxIAl SuBluxATIonIndividuals with Downs Syndrome are at risk of having a condition known as Atlanto-Axial Subluxation. HISRA must have a doctor’s written note on file stating a participant is free of the instability if he/she wishes to participate in programs that may cause undue stress upon the neck. Please take this into consideration when registering and inform staff if the condition is present.

HISRA is the result of a desire on the part of your park district to provide quality recreation programs and services to individuals with disabilities and special needs. HISRA and its member districts enthusiastically support the spirit and intent of the Americans With Disabilities Act. HISRA is committed to providing opportunities for each individual to enjoy recreation activities in the least restrictive environment possible.

peoria Wildcats Wheelchair basketballThis program is designed to increase physical ability and provide the opportunity to participate in competitive sports! To be eligible for play in adapted sports, a player must have an irreversible lower extremity disability, such as paralysis, amputation, radiological evidence of limb shortening, partial to full joint alkalosis or joint replacement, which consistently interferes with functional mobility. (Findings such as soft tissue contracture, ligament instability, edema or disuse atrophy, or symptoms such as pain or numbness, without other objective fi ndings shall not be considered lower extremity disability.) The team travels to games and tournaments around Illinois and surrounding states. During the 2011-2012 season, the Peoria Wildcats placed ninth at the National Tournament in Colorado Springs, Colorado! Game and tournament times for the 2012-2013 season are TBA.

Code of ConduCT• The following guidelines have been developed to help

make the Heart of Illinois Special Recreation Association (HISRA) programs and services safe and enjoyable for all participants. Additional rules may be developed for partic-ular programs as deemed necessary by staff. The team at HISRA is committed to providing a safe, needs-satisfying, growth-oriented experience for every participant. We believe discipline is not merely a list of expectations, but rather an approach to teaching skills in self-control, responsible choice making, and appropriate community participation.

• A positive approach will be used regarding discipline. Staff will periodically review rules with participants during the program session. Prompt resolution will be sought specific to each individual situation. HISRA reserves the right to dismiss a participant whose behavior endangers the safety of himself or others assuming the procedures listed below are implemented and followed accordingly.

• Individual needs are taken into consideration. Disability information should be identified in advance to the pro-gram supervisor/staff so appropriate supports may be put in place. Please be sure your Annual Information Form is current and update staff with any changes.

• The following are guidelines that may be imposed in the disciplinary action process. These guidelines in no way guarantee that a participant will necessarily receive each level before dismissal based on the severity of the ac-tion. Also, please note that when programs are held at non-HISRA/Park District facilities, private facility rules take precedence over program code of conduct.

level 1The resolution of Level 1 behaviors is primarily the responsibility of program leaders and staff members. Level 1 behaviors include, but are not limited to the following:• Purposely distracting others• Inappropriate remarks• Inappropriate contact• Littering• Inappropriate dress• Pushing and/or shoving• Profanity and/or obscenity• Excessive/loud talking• Throwing objects• Refusal to follow instruction

level 2These interventions are the responsibility of Program Supervisor (or designee) with assistance from leaders/staff. Level 2 behaviors include, but are not limited to the following:• Possession of harmful objects• Discriminatory conduct• Intimidation/threats• Possession of stolen property• Unauthorized gambling• Theft• Damage to property• Persistent Level 1 behaviors• Disregard for others’ safety• Fighting, kicking, biting, spitting, pinching• Leaving grounds without permission

level 3These interventions are the responsibility of the Program Supervisor with consultation from Executive Director. Level 3 behaviors include, but are not limited to the following:• Persistent Level 2 behaviors• Arson/attempted arson• Sexual Misconduct • Possession of explosives• Burglary/robbery• Group violence• Use/possession of a weapon• Bomb threats• Use of a tool as a weapon• Endangerment• Vandalism• Fire alarms• Possession of stolen property• Interference with staff authority• Severe or repeated physical aggression• Abuse and/or harassment: verbal, physical, sexual, and

emotional

each inDiviDual behavioR Will be aDDResseD on a case-by-case basis With consiDeRation of inDiviDual Disabilities, meDical issues anD behavioR plans.
